For the 2025-26 school year, there is 1 public school serving 410 students in Latino College Preparatory Academy School District. This district's average test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in California.
Public School in Latino College Preparatory Academy School District have an average math proficiency score of 5% (versus the California public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 32% (versus the 47%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 100%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the California public school average of 80% (majority Hispanic).

The revenue/student of $16,600 in this school district is less than the state median of $19,978.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$13,727 is less than the state median of $18,399.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
